syncookies: use SipHash in place of SHA1
SHA1 is slower and less secure than SipHash, and so replacing syncookie generation with SipHash makes natural sense. Some BSDs have been doing this for several years in fact. The speedup should be similar -- and even more impressive -- to the speedup from the sequence number fix in this series. Signed-off-by: Jason A.
